Yoga not only has significant impact on health and wellbeing of adults and kids, but it surely helps in bringing about significant changes in lives of kids having Autism Spectrum Disorder, Attention Deficit Disorder, Hyperactivity, etc. Children with neurodevelopmental disorders often face challenges such as difficulty with sensory regulation, motor coordination, emotional regulation, and social interaction. Yoga, with its blend of physical postures (asanas), breathing exercises (pranayama), and mindfulness techniques, provides a gentle yet effective way to address these challenges. Here’s how yoga can make a differenc e: Improves Sensory Processing Kids with sensory processing disorders often struggle with over- or under-sensitivity to stimuli like sound, touch, or movement.
